My favorite is Shrine of the Storm. I like the layout, the theme, and the constant use of interrupts being so important. I feel all the bosses are also well done and unique.

Least favorite is Seige of Borallus. I dislike all the stuns you have to move for, bosses feel a bit gimmicky, and too much of the scenery gets in the way making me adjust my camera. With all the moving around dodging stun mechanics I feel like I am constantly rearranging my camera.

I enjoy Waycrest a lot. It has a unique aesthetic as far as WoW dungeons go. Plus it’s a good challenge on most affixes, but it usually doesn’t feel too over the top.

Another one I somehow like is Temple of Sethraliss. Sure, the third boss can drive me crazy, but I like the atmosphere and the creative mechanics as far as dungeons go.

I never enjoy Shrine. It’s a slog no matter what.

Atal’dazar is another one that I don’t particularly enjoy, and it’s mostly because the dungeon doesn’t feel memorable. I use it more as a warm up dungeon.
